A specialized aviation team successfully executed an emergency medical evacuation from the remote McMurdo Station in Antarctica, according to BBC News — World. The mission required the crew to land an aircraft in conditions of total darkness while contending with severe environmental hazards, including temperatures plummeting to -43°C.

Such operations in Antarctica remain rare due to the logistical intensity of maintaining landing strips during the winter season. The successful recovery highlights the specialized training required for polar aviation, where equipment failure or meteorological shifts pose immediate threats to safety.
